Popular JavaScript Frameworks and Libraries
1. React
- Overview: Developed and maintained by Facebook, React is a library for building user interfaces, particularly single-page applications where data changes over time.
- Key Features:
- Component-based architecture
- Virtual DOM for efficient updates
- Extensive ecosystem with tools like Redux and React Router
- Influence: React’s approach to component-based development has set a new standard for building UIs, promoting reusability and maintainability. It has a huge community and a wealth of third-party libraries and tools.
2. Angular
- Overview: Maintained by Google, Angular is a full-fledged framework for building dynamic web applications. It uses TypeScript, a statically typed superset of JavaScript.
- Key Features:
- Two-way data binding
- Dependency injection
- Comprehensive tooling with Angular CLI
- Influence: Angular’s comprehensive nature makes it a go-to choice for large-scale applications. Its strict structure and powerful features have influenced best practices in enterprise-level application development.
3. Vue.js
- Overview: Created by Evan You, Vue.js is a progressive framework for building user interfaces. It is designed to be incrementally adoptable.
- Key Features:
- Reactive data binding
- Component-based development
- Simple integration with other projects and libraries
- Influence: Vue’s simplicity and flexibility make it a popular choice for both small projects and large applications. It has a growing community and is praised for its gentle learning curve.
4. Node.js
- Overview: Node.js is a runtime environment that allows JavaScript to be used for server-side scripting, enabling the development of scalable network applications.
- Key Features:
- Non-blocking, event-driven architecture
- NPM (Node Package Manager) for managing packages
- Extensive ecosystem with frameworks like Express.js
- Influence: Node.js has expanded JavaScript’s use beyond the browser, allowing developers to use a single language for both client-side and server-side development. This has led to the rise of full-stack JavaScript development.
How Frameworks and Libraries Influence Software Development
1. Accelerating Development
Frameworks and libraries provide pre-built components and tools that simplify and speed up the development process. For example, React’s component-based architecture allows developers to build reusable components, reducing redundancy and speeding up development.
2. Standardizing Best Practices
Frameworks like Angular enforce a structured approach to development, which helps in maintaining consistency and quality across large teams. This standardization of best practices ensures that codebases are more maintainable and scalable.
3. Enhancing Performance
Many frameworks and libraries come with performance optimizations out-of-the-box. React’s virtual DOM, for instance, minimizes direct manipulation of the real DOM, leading to faster updates and better performance in complex applications.
4. Promoting Community and Ecosystem Growth
The popularity of frameworks and libraries fosters large, active communities. These communities contribute to a rich ecosystem of plugins, extensions, and tools that further enhance development capabilities. For example, the extensive collection of middleware and plugins available for Express.js makes it easier to build robust Node.js applications.
5. Enabling Full-Stack Development
With the advent of frameworks like Node.js, JavaScript has become a language that can be used across the entire stack, from client-side scripting to server-side logic and even database interactions (e.g., using MongoDB). This unification simplifies the development process and allows for more cohesive development teams.
